About Us

Stella Maris is the largest ship-visiting network in the world, and the official maritime charity of the Catholic Church. We have 220 chaplains supporting seafarers in 54 countries around the world.

Our Work

Life at sea can be difficult and seafarers can suffer from loneliness, depression, spiritual deprivation, and even exploitation. Our chaplains and volunteers visit hundreds of thousands of seafarers every year.

Our History

Stella Maris was founded in Glasgow in 1920 by a group of Catholic men and women with the founding belief that every seafarer deserves fair working conditions and respect for their human rights.
